Bill Summary
General Description: This bill changes the allocation of money from a historical support special group license plate.
AI Summary
This bill makes several amendments to Utah's special group license plate statutes, with key changes focused on the historical support special group license plate and expanding the types of sponsored special group license plates. Specifically, the bill creates new categories of special group license plates including corporate brand sponsored and major league sports team sponsored plates, and modifies how contributions from these plates are allocated. For the historical support special group license plate, beginning July 1, 2025, the $25 voluntary contribution will be split, with $2 going to the Utah State Historical Society and $23 going to the Transportation Investment Fund. Additionally, the bill transfers $3.5 million from the Sponsored Special Group License Plate Fund to the General Fund for fiscal year 2025. The bill also removes some previous requirements about displaying unique license plates for vintage vehicles and expands the ways collegiate institutions can use funds from their special license plates, such as for student athlete name, image, and likeness compensation. The bill takes effect on July 1, 2025, and makes numerous technical changes to definitions and administrative procedures related to special group license plates.
